Hemp Protein Softgels

Hemp protein softgels are a convenient source of plant-based protein derived from hemp seeds, rich in essential fatty acids and amino acids. They provide a nutritious supplement for those seeking to enhance their protein intake.

Hemp protein is a complete protein, containing all nine essential amino acids, making it an excellent choice for vegetarians and vegans.
Rich in omega-3 and omega-6 fatty acids, hemp protein supports heart health and may help reduce inflammation.

Acai Powder

Acai powder is derived from the acai berry, known for its high antioxidant content and potential health benefits, including heart health and weight management.

Rich in antioxidants, acai powder helps combat oxidative stress and may reduce the risk of chronic diseases.
May support heart health by improving cholesterol levels and promoting healthy blood circulation.
